What Is a Butterfly Haircut?
A butterfly haircut is a layered hairstyle that combines shorter face-framing layers with longer layers throughout the rest of the hair.
The result creates two visual lengths:
- Shorter layers around the face for softness and volume
- Longer layers underneath that preserve overall length
Unlike choppy layered cuts, butterfly layers blend seamlessly, creating movement without harsh transitions.

What Causes Frizzy Hair?
Frizz can happen for several reasons, and understanding the cause can help you care for your hair more effectively.
Common causes include:
- Humidity
- Dry hair
- Heat damage
- Chemical treatments
- Natural curl patterns
- Overwashing
- Rough towel drying
- Split ends
A butterfly haircut won’t eliminate frizz entirely, but it can make it easier to manage by improving the overall shape of your hair.

How to Style a Butterfly Cut for Frizzy Hair
Proper styling can dramatically improve manageability.
Apply Leave-In Conditioner
Hydration is essential for reducing frizz.
Use Heat Protectant
Protect hair before blow drying or using hot tools.
Blow Dry with a Round Brush
Smooth the layers while maintaining movement.
Finish with Lightweight Oil
A few drops reduce flyaways and add shine.
Avoid Over-Brushing Dry Hair
Too much brushing can increase frizz and disrupt the layered shape.

How Often Should You Trim a Butterfly Cut?
Regular trims help maintain healthy ends and balanced layers.
Recommended schedule:
- Every 8 to 10 weeks for maintenance
- Every 6 to 8 weeks if you have bangs
- Every 10 to 12 weeks when growing your hair longer
Routine trims also help reduce split ends that contribute to frizz.
